Author:  geordi [ Mon Aug 15, 2011 3:58 pm ]
Post subject:  timing belt tool(s) question

The two locking pins for the cams are supposed to be different, the head on one is larger than the other, and the length is slightly different. IIRC, the exhaust side uses a smaller hex head, the intake side is larger and I believe the length is the longer one.

The flex plate (flywheel) pin is the longest, and almost smooth except for a knurled grip and the protruding threads. This one isn't truly needed for the timing job... But it helps line everything up. When the pins are all in, the factory witness marks on the crank should be at 12'o clock, the fuel pump witness should point at its mate on the cover (when you reset everything, not at first with the old belt) and the cams... Depend on if anyone ever unlocked the pulleys. If not, they should point at each other.

When following the directions for setting the timing and rotating the engine by hand, the fuel pump must start at its witness mark, but will NOT be back at the witness mark after 2 rotations. This is ok.

For this kit.... I believe these pins would be correct for the 2.8 engine as well, the large hex head pin and the small hex head pin look correct, as does the longer of the two smooth pins. Not sure what the shorter smooth pin is for, or the coiled-looking pin. The last tool there is the tensioner-arm tool, there is not a camshaft pulley lock with that set. Strictly speaking, you don't need the pulley lock to do the job, but you can't put a lot of tension on the pins and expect them to hold.

Author:  geordi [ Mon Aug 15, 2011 4:06 pm ]
Post subject:  timing belt tool(s) question

Two cam locking pins are needed, I didn't think they were both 1053 tho. They are slightly different, as pictured. The cam gear holding tool is not pictured there (as it exists for our 2.8 engines) it is a big trapezoid with a handle and two knobs. That tool is used to properly grip and lock both cam gears while installing the belt, as the pins are locating devices only - they cannot hold against the torque of messing with the cam gear nuts, should you need to.

Author:  dirtmover [ Thu Aug 18, 2011 12:58 pm ]
Post subject:  Re: timing belt tool(s) question

From the instructions on that page this kit is for the following engines

Chrysler Voyager 2.5 | 2.8 CRD VM Engine R2516C | R2816C5.05A 01-2008
Grand Voyager 2.5 | 2.8 CRD VM Engine R2516C | R2816C5.05A 01-2008
LDV Maxus 2.5 | 2.8 CRD VM Engine R2516L VM39/40B 05-2009

and here are the VM part numbers for the equivalent tools

VM 1068 | LDV196 Flywheel Locking Pin
VM 1089 | LDV196 Flywheel Locking Pin
VM 1053 | LDV193 Camshaft Locking Pin - Exhaust
VM 1052 | LDV192 Camshaft Locking Pin - Inlet
VM 1074 Cam belt Holding Tool
VM 9660 | H2587 Belt Tensioner Wrench

What is holding the cams to tighten the gear bolts? The locking pins? I am planning on removing both gears to remove the rear cover so I can get at the water pump.

Author:  geordi [ Fri Aug 19, 2011 2:12 pm ]
Post subject:  Re: timing belt tool(s) question

The pins can exert some force, but not enough to hold the cams solid against that locking torque. That is where the cam tool comes in. You are seating the cams onto a tapered shaft so as they get tighter, the taper transfers the rotational force into the holding tool and away from the pins.

Its not a great design, IMHO. I don't know what possessed them to design a system where the cams had to be adjustable like that, without using something like a set screw to keep them solidly in place.
